About the role
- This is a temporary, paid internship for the Fall 2026 term, based out of our New York (Fashion District) office.
- Reporting to the Influencer Campaign Manager, with guidance from the Sr.
- Director of Digital and Content, you'll get hands-on exposure to sourcing, coordinating, and supporting influencer partnerships.
Responsibilities
- Influencer Research & List-Building - Support the team in identifying and compiling lists of emerging U.S. creators across TikTok, Instagram, YouTube, and LinkedIn for review.
- Outreach & Coordination Support - Assist with influencer outreach, scheduling, and day-to-day communication to help keep campaigns and events on track.
- Briefing Support - Assist in preparing campaign briefs and organizing reference materials for influencers.
- Mailer Program Support - Support the sourcing and organization of recipient lists for influencer mailer programs.
- Administrative Support - Assist with building and maintaining trackers, recaps, and other documentation related to influencer campaigns.
- Surprise + Delights - Research and support moments for client always-on gifting opportunities including talent search, product pickup/drop-off and fast coordination
Requirements
- Currently pursuing or recently completed a degree in Marketing, Communications, Public Relations, or a related field.
- Familiarity with major social platforms (TikTok, Instagram, Pinterest, Twitch, YouTube) and an eye for emerging creators and trends.
- Must be available to work in-office in New York (Fashion District) for the duration of the internship.
-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.

Compensation
- $18.00 hourly. Students may also receive academic credit in addition to pay, if approved by their institution.
- This position is classified as non-exempt under the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A), and interns will be eligible for overtime pay in accordance with applicable laws.
